> This series aims to add the xSMI support on the xMDIO bus to the > mvmdio driver. The xSMI interface complies with the IEEE 802.3 clause 45 > and is used by 10GbE devices. On 7k and 8k (as of now), such an > interface is found and is used by Ethernet controllers. > > Patches 1-4 and 9 are cosmetic cleanups. > > Patches 5-7 are prerequisites to the xSMI support. > > Patches 8 and 10-11 add the xSMI support to the mvmdio driver, and a > node is added both in the cp110 slave and master device trees. > > This was tested on an Armada 8040 mcbin, as well as on both the > Armada 7040 DB and the Armada 8040 DB to ensure the SMI interface > was still working. > > @Dave: patch 11 should go through the mvebu tree as asked by Gregory, > thanks!
